Description

The Client Onboarding Team is responsible for client experience, implementing and managing a smooth process to handle all of the aspects of onboarding a client to ensure that they are ready to do business with Capital Markets (across all asset classes).

Role

The Client Onboarding Advocate role will involve simplifying the client experience and eliminating delays by taking ownership and mobilising the appropriate resources to ensure a timely and satisfactory resolution for the client and Citi.

Working in partnership with clients and several teams in Sales, Legal, Compliance, Credit, Operations, etc to ensure that time to market is minimized and the client receives exemplary service on their introduction to Citi.

Additionally the candidate will be responsible for identifying opportunities to centralize and optimize the processes to constantly improve client satisfaction and the overall group performance.
